Friends of the Carpenter


  • About Us

    We are a faith-based, non-profit day facility that provides structure, safety and purpose to vulnerable members of our community.  Through safe and supervised activities of simple woodcraft, people experience “sanctuary” where everyone is welcomed, accepted and respected. Through caring friendships, God’s love is the glue that fits us together and builds up the church and “parts of” the Body of Christ.
